"Rare earth elements are the key components of the emerging green technologies such as wind turbines, hybrid vehicles and storage batteries. The expected demand and current production rate is forecasted to result to a short supply of La, Nd, Pr, Dy, and Tb by 2025. This global demand can only be met with constant development of new mines outside of China. Among the projects being developed outside China located in Canada, Niobec rare earth project of Magris Resources Inc. is found to contain the largest resource of rare earth elements with 1058.6 million tonnes at 1.73% total rare earth oxide. The fine grain sizes (-20 [mu]m) of the rare earth minerals present in this ore makes froth flotation the most applicable beneficiation technique for separation. However, literature regarding rare earth mineral flotation is very limited. To process the rare earth ore, fundamental properties of the pure minerals (monazite, bastnäsite and dolomite) must be first then understood through surface characterization (e.g., ATR-FTIR and XPS), thermodynamic calculations (speciation diagrams), electrophoretic measurements (i.e., zeta potential measurements) and single-mineral microflotation tests using three different rare earth mineral collectors, benzohydroxamate, sodium oleate and organic phosphoric acid. Density Functional Theory (DFT)-based molecular modeling were also utilised and was found useful in validating the experimental results. It provided a deeper understanding of the mineral-collector interaction and presented possible conformation of adsorbed species or collectors on the surface of the minerals. The DFT simulations were also able to provide explanation to phenomena that could not be explained with experimental observations alone. The insights acquired through fundamental investigations and the knowledge of the mineralogy provided guidance in the processing of the ore. The observed concentration of rare earth elements in the fine (-20 [mu]m) fraction led to a decision to split the processing of the ore into two routes. This does not only prevent overgrinding of the -20 [mu]m particles, but also achieves a more efficient grinding of the +20 [mu]m particles. The use of specially designed column cell in processing the fines showed significant enrichment and recovery of the rare earth elements. This result was achieved with only one stage of rougher flotation, which was typically obtained through several stages of roughing and cleaning/scavenging. An improvement in the column cell parameters (mechanical aspect) and further investigations regarding the reagent scheme (chemistry aspect) are suggested for future work." --

Reagents in Mineral Technology provides comprehensive coverage of both basic as well asapplied aspects of reagents utilized in the minerals industry.This outstanding, single-source reference opens with an explicit account of flotation fundamentals,including coverage of wetting phenomena, mineral/water interfacial phenomena, flo tationchemistry, and flocculation and dispersion of mineral suspensions.It then discusses flotation of sulfide and nonsulfide minerals, with attention to formation ofclithiolates, formation of metal thiol compounds, application of fatty acids, sulfosuccinic acids,amines, and other collectors.Reagents in Mineral Technology also reviews adsorption of surfactants on minerals .. .details adsorption of polymers .. . and considers the chemistry and application of chelation agentsin minerals separations.Additional chapters consider grinding aids, frothers, inorganic and polymeric depressants,dewatering and filtering aids, analytical techniques, and much more.Unique in its depth of coverage, Reagents in Mineral Technology will prove an invaluablereference for mineral engineers and processors; analytical, surface, colloid, and physical chemists;petroleum, petrochemical, metallurgical, and mining engineers; and for use in advancedundergraduate- and graduate-level courses in these and related fields.

Rare Earths elements are composed of 15 chemical elements in the periodic table. Scandium and yttrium have similar properties, with mineral assemblages, and are therefore referred alike in the literature. Although abundant in the planet surface, the Rare Earths are not found in concentrated forms, thus making them economically valued as they are so challenging to obtain. Rare Earths Industry: Technological, Economic and Environmental Implications provides an interdisciplinary orientation to the topic of Rare Earths with a focus on technical, scientific, academic, economic, and environmental issues. Part I of book deals with the Rare Earths Reserves and Mining, Part II focuses on Rare Earths Processes and High-Tech Product Development, and Part III deals with Rare Earths Recycling Opportunities and Challenges. The chapters provide updated information and priceless analysis of the theme, and they seek to present the latest techniques, approaches, processes and technologies that can reduce the costs of compliance with environmental concerns in a way it is possible to anticipate and mitigate emerging problems.
